    Keep CC or get a Cheap 1x1?

    Here is my dilemma. I found a heck of a deal on Rootbeer Vaya on CL, barely ridden, for $850 about a year ago. It replaced my Mist Grey CC as my all around "road" bike. The CC has been sitting in my garage, it is in great shape. I was thinking of converting it to a SS to use as a commuter/beach beater. Trader Joe's is less than a mile, the beach is about a mile, and work is about two miles. Plus grab some breakfast/lunch on the weekends. I don't have to worry about it at work and probably not much at TJs, but at the beach . . . I don't really like cruisers.

    The problem is that the CC is n really good shape and I was afraid it would be prone to theft. So, I was thinking of selling and picking up an older 1x1 that is more beatup and less of a temptation to thieves. I figure the CC would get about $650 and I could get a cheaper 1x1 and use the extra cash for racks/basket/tweaks. Or if I keep the CC spend a couple of hundred bucks converting it to a SS and worry about thieves.

    Thoughts

    If you want a 1x1, get that, but I don't see it financially making sense: the frames are about the same price from Surly, and they've both been around long enough that they're fairly common, so I don't see the used prices differing that much.

    You could just space out a cog on your rear wheel, sell off the shifty bits, and use those proceeds to buy a basket, rack, and fenders. Then cover your CC in tape or stickers or something so it doesn't look so nice!

    I'm not really seeing how a 1x1 would be less tempting to theives. Maybe an old beater rigid mountain bike from the thrift store is more along those lines. Or a Worksman.

    But if you want a 1x1, get a 1x1. Might be a nice change of pace from the CC. Less similar to the Vaya too. A 1x1 with some big Hookworm tires would be a pretty cool beach bike - you could even ride it on the sand I bet.
